P.N. Raju (San Francisco, CA) finished 4-0 in the 0-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Raju defeated
Michael Greene (Syosset, NY) 9-2, then won 13-3 against Matthew Urbaniak (Dayton, OH) and 8-5 against Buck Krawczyk (Austin, TX). Raju won 8-5 against Jon Penney (Cincinnati, OH) in their final qualifying round match.
